This charming three bedroom period property is situated in an idyllic location and boasts a plethora of desirable features. Upon entering the property, you are greeted by a convenient w.c and a walk-through area to the kitchen, which offers plenty of storage space. The living area is a real highlight of the property, with its stunning period features and direct access to the garden.

Upstairs, the property comprises three generously sized double bedrooms, one of which benefits from an ensuite shower room, and a separate family bathroom. All of the bedrooms are flooded with natural light, creating a bright and airy atmosphere.

The garden is a true oasis of tranquillity, offering a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. There is a summer house which is a great place to enjoy those summer evenings, as well as a studio, with power, fantastic for the family to enjoy. There are various different areas to sit and enjoy the beautiful surroundings. This property is perfect for those seeking a peaceful and idyllic lifestyle, while still being within easy reach of local amenities.

Hunton is an idyllic village in Kent on the outskirts of Maidstone, with many a country pub nearby. Maidstone town centre is nearby offering an array of services for commuting along with shops, restaurants and activities for all the family to enjoy.

Property was rewired in 2019

    Broadband availability and predicted speed

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
